Understanding the Two Shopping Models

Before comparing costs and benefits, it's important to understand how these systems operate.

What Is ACBuy?

ACBuy is a digital purchasing and parcel forwarding platform designed to simplify cross-border shopping. Instead of selling products directly, it acts as an intermediary between buyers and Chinese online marketplaces.

Its typical services include:

  • Purchasing products on behalf of customers

  • Receiving items at a Chinese warehouse

  • Conducting basic quality inspections

  • Offering package consolidation

  • Managing international shipping

Most transactions are completed through an online dashboard, allowing users to monitor every stage of the purchasing process.

What Are Traditional Buying Agents?

Traditional buying agents are individuals or small businesses that manually source products for clients.

They usually operate through:

  • Messaging applications

  • Social media platforms

  • Private online communities

Their responsibilities often include:

  • Finding products

  • Negotiating with sellers

  • Purchasing items

  • Packaging orders

  • Arranging shipment abroad

Unlike digital platforms, traditional agents rely heavily on personal communication and established customer relationships.

Shipping Efficiency and Cost Optimization

Shipping expenses frequently determine whether overseas shopping remains worthwhile.

ACBuy Shipping Features

One of ACBuy's strongest advantages is warehouse-based logistics.

Common services include:

Package Consolidation

Combining multiple purchases into one shipment.

Benefits:

  • Lower shipping costs

  • Fewer parcels

  • Simplified customs processing

Packaging Optimization

Warehouse staff may:

  • Remove retail boxes

  • Compress clothing

  • Repackage items

  • Reduce unnecessary filler materials

These adjustments can significantly lower volumetric shipping costs.

Multiple Shipping Routes

Buyers often have access to:

  • Express couriers

  • Standard air freight

  • Economy shipping options

This flexibility allows customers to balance speed and affordability.

Traditional Buying Agents

Shipping procedures vary widely.

Some agents:

  • Ship items individually

  • Use preferred logistics providers

  • Offer limited shipping choices

Packaging optimization depends entirely on the individual agent's practices.

Winner: ACBuy

For shoppers focused on reducing logistics expenses, ACBuy generally provides more tools and flexibility.
